What to check before for buildings with low eviction rates in NYC

  • Expect a lower likelihood of eviction issues, which can enhance rental stability.
  • Confirm lease terms carefully; even low-eviction buildings may have restrictions.
  • Understand that while low-eviction rates are encouraging, conditions can still change.
  • Inquire about building management practices, as they can impact your experience.
